Ideas for preemie hat patterns

I am doing some preemie hat charity knitting right now, and I am looking for more ideas for hat patterns. So far, I have done the following hats plus one that looks kind of like Fair Isle only it was suuuuper simple because tiny hats have only so much space.

Preemie hats
from left to right: cream bear/rabbit hat, shrek hat, eggplant/berry hat

I am trying to make pretty/silly hats, and I have boatloads of those three colors (purple, green, creamy yellow). I got ideas for the above hats from Ravelry and kind of made them preemie sized.

I'm trying to make hats that are fun for parents to look at when they're worried about their kids, and also are not uncomfortable to lie on if you are a baby (so the things that stick out are on the top, not on the sides, etc.) and won't get caught in tubes.

If you have any ideas for fun patterns I could try, I'd really appreciate it. Even if it's just "Make a hat to look like X" with no pattern, I could always try adapting it anway. Thank you!

My only suggestion is that you use super soft yarn in cotton for preemie hats. My cousin had two preemies, and their skin is amazingly delicate. Plus kids may have allergies to acrylic or animal fibers that they're not aware of yet. (This may not be true for all preemies. Or even all kids. I come from a family with excessive allergies.)
